Created by Marvel writer Mike Friedrich and writer-artist Jim Starlin, Thanos first appeared in Iron Man #55 (cover is dated Feb. 1973). His saga is quite complex but much of his most popular storyline revolves around the collection of the infinity stones to gain omnipotence and destroy half of the universe for Mistress Death.
